Best CNC Machining Training in Baltimore (2026): Costs, Free Programs & Online Options

The Baltimore metropolitan area is in the middle of a major industrial shift, moving from legacy manufacturing into a more advanced ecosystem built around precision production, industrial maintenance, aerospace supply chains, and emerging clean-energy work. That shift has made Computer Numerical Control (CNC) machining one of the most practical career paths for students, working adults, and career changers who want a technical skill set with long-term value.

The challenge is that CNC training in Baltimore is not one single pathway. Some students want a public college certificate. Some want a full associate degree. Some want a fast workforce program. Some need a fully online option they can finish around a job. And some want a paid apprenticeship that lets them earn while they learn.

In this guide, we break down the best CNC machining training options in Baltimore, including tuition where available, what each program teaches, and why Machining Tutor is the best online option for students who want structure without the commute.

Quick summary: Baltimore has strong CNC options through CCBC, Harford Community College, UMBC’s online training, Phillips Haas training, Maryland apprenticeship pathways, and Maryland MEP workforce support. Machining Tutor removes the biggest barriers with structured lessons, AI support, and career help.

1. Community College of Baltimore County (CCBC) – Best Public College Path

CCBC is the main public anchor for machining training in the Baltimore area. Its CNC Machinist Certificate is a 34-credit in-person program at Catonsville that is designed to prepare students for work as a CNC machine operator, machinist, or set-up person. CCBC also offers an Advanced Industrial Design and Technology AAS degree that includes CNC machining and broader fabrication and manufacturing skills.

  • CNC Machinist Certificate: 34 credits
  • AAS option: Advanced Industrial Design and Technology, 60–61 credits
  • Location: Catonsville
  • Focus: CNC machining, manual machining, fabrication, design, and quality skills
  • Best for: Students who want the strongest affordable public college option

CCBC also keeps costs relatively accessible for Baltimore County residents. For academic year 2025–2026, the college lists tuition and fees at $124 per credit for Baltimore County residents, with additional fees applying depending on course type. That makes CCBC one of the most practical public routes into machining in the region.

Best for: Students who want the strongest affordable public college path in Baltimore.

2. CCBC CNC Machine Tool Short-Term Training – Best Fast-Track Public Option

CCBC also offers a CNC Machine Tool short-term training program through continuing education. This is a 600-hour program built around hands-on shop training, workplace literacy, safety, quality, blueprint reading, trade math, manual machining, CNC technology, and resume/interview skills. It is designed for students who want a faster workforce entry path than a traditional degree.

  • Length: 600 hours
  • Estimated cost: $8,799 total
  • Format: In-person continuing education
  • Focus: Manual and CNC machine tool technology, workplace literacy, safety, blueprint reading
  • Best for: Students who want a fast-track public-school route into machining

The practical advantage of this path is the amount of direct machine time. It is built for people who want concentrated, job-focused training instead of a longer academic sequence.

Best for: Students who want a short, hands-on public college training option.

3. Harford Community College – Best Northern Corridor Option

Harford Community College offers Basic Machine Manufacturing Technology, which teaches students to use lathes, milling machines, grinders, and blueprint reading to produce precision parts and tools. It is a strong option for students in the northern Baltimore corridor who want a practical introduction to machining and manufacturing.

  • Program: Basic Machine Manufacturing Technology
  • Focus: Lathes, milling machines, grinders, and blueprint reading
  • Best for: Students in the northern Baltimore area
  • Strength: Practical manual-to-manufacturing foundation

Harford also offers an online CNC Machinist training course through its career training platform. The course is self-paced, lasts 12 months, and includes 195 course hours. It provides an intensive overview of workholding, math, inspection, safety, metal cutting, materials, quality, and grinding. The listed price is $2,245.

Best for: Students who want a northern corridor option or a flexible online CNC course.

4. Phillips Haas Training – Best for Haas Shops and Current Machinists

Phillips Corporation provides hands-on Haas CNC training designed around real machine time instead of lecture-heavy instruction. Its catalog includes beginner mill and lathe operator courses, maintenance and repair training, advanced UMC training, and service certification. This makes Phillips especially useful for shops that already run Haas equipment and want their operators or maintenance teams trained on the exact control and machine family they use every day.

  • Basic Mill Operator Training: 2 days, $2,200
  • Basic Lathe Operator Training: 2 days, $2,200
  • Maintenance & Repair Training: 5 days
  • Advanced UMC Training: 5 days, $4,400
  • Best for: Current machinists and Haas shops

This is not a beginner school in the traditional sense. It is a strong choice for operators, service technicians, and employers who want specific Haas-focused upskilling, faster troubleshooting, and less dependence on outside service calls.

Best for: Current machinists working with Haas machines.

5. Maryland Office of Apprenticeship – Best Paid Pathway

Maryland’s Office of Apprenticeship is the state’s official Registered Apprenticeship hub. It supports programs where workers earn a paycheck while gaining hands-on experience, classroom instruction, and mentorship. That makes apprenticeship one of the strongest options for students who want to avoid traditional school debt and move directly into the workforce.

  • Format: Earn while you learn
  • Support: Registered apprenticeship, mentorship, and classroom instruction
  • Best for: Students who want a paid pathway into machining
  • Career value: Job-ready experience with employer backing

The state also maintains an apprenticeship locator and navigator support, which helps students and employers connect to the right program. For Baltimore students, apprenticeship is one of the clearest ways to build a machining career while avoiding the financial pressure of a conventional college route.

Best for: Students who want paid training and direct job experience.

6. Maryland MEP and Offshore Wind Support – Best Workforce Bridge

Maryland MEP plays an important supporting role in the region’s manufacturing ecosystem. Its e2m2 program helps manufacturers with energy and environmental assessments and connects businesses to incentives, grants, and sustainability support. Maryland’s offshore wind strategy also reinforces the need for a skilled manufacturing workforce, especially in supply chain, fabrication, and precision production roles.

For students, this matters because it signals where opportunity is growing. As more advanced manufacturing activity expands in Maryland, machinists with CNC, quality, and production skills are well positioned for the jobs that follow.

Best for: Students and employers looking at the broader manufacturing pipeline.


Why Machining Tutor Is the Best Online CNC Option for Baltimore Students

Baltimore has several strong local options, but every local option still has a barrier: schedule, commute, cost, or access. Machining Tutor removes those barriers and gives you a structured online CNC path from anywhere. The platform includes 118+ lessons across 9 modules, 24/7 AI Machining Tutor support, direct technical help, full CAD/CAM training, resume review, and job search assistance.

Machining Tutor’s pricing is simple: $89 per month, $495 per year, or $995 lifetime. It also gives students a 14-day money-back guarantee and a clear beginner-to-pro path that is built for real-world CNC learning.

The biggest advantage is simple: you can start now. No commuting. No waiting for a semester. No need to already be inside a shop or apprenticeship pipeline before you begin learning the fundamentals.

Want to start CNC training without waiting for a class?

If you want a flexible way to build CNC skills from anywhere, Machining Tutor gives you structured lessons, AI support, and a clear path forward.

Start Learning CNC for Free

Which CNC Training Option in Baltimore Is Best?

The best choice depends on your goal:

  • Best affordable public college path: CCBC CNC Machinist Certificate
  • Best fast-track public option: CCBC CNC Machine Tool Short-Term Training
  • Best northern corridor option: Harford Community College
  • Best Haas-specific upskilling: Phillips Haas Training
  • Best paid apprenticeship path: Maryland Office of Apprenticeship
  • Best online option overall: Machining Tutor

Baltimore offers a strong mix of public college training, short-term workforce programs, vendor-specific technical training, and apprenticeship pathways. If you want the most traditional route, CCBC is the anchor. If you want something faster and more hands-on, CCBC’s short-term program is strong. If you want online flexibility, Harford and UMBC both give you structured remote options. And if you want to start immediately with the least friction, Machining Tutor is the easiest place to begin.


Frequently Asked Questions About CNC Training in Baltimore

How long does it take to learn CNC machining in Baltimore?

It depends on the path. Some online courses take about 12 months, while certificates, apprenticeships, and degrees can take much longer.

Can I learn CNC machining online in Baltimore?

Yes. Harford and UMBC both offer online CNC machining options, and Machining Tutor gives you a fully structured online CNC learning path.

Is CNC machining a good career in Baltimore?

Yes. Baltimore’s manufacturing and industrial base still needs skilled machinists, especially as advanced manufacturing, defense supply chains, and clean-energy work continue to grow.

Do I need experience before starting CNC training?

No. Many programs begin with math, safety, measurement, blueprint reading, and manual machining before moving into CNC setup and programming.

What is the best online CNC option for Baltimore students?

Machining Tutor is the best online option because it combines structured lessons, AI help, direct support, and career guidance in one place.

JOIN OUR MAILING LIST

Machining Tutor is the premier online training platform for future CNC professionals.

We combine immersive, real-world video lessons with 24/7 AI Mentorship and Live 1-on-1 Classes to take you from 'Zero Knowledge' to 'Job-Ready' in record time.

Stop guessing and start mastering G-Code, CAD/CAM, and Machine Setup today.

G Code LTD

71-75 Shelton Street

London, United Kingdom

Newsletter

Subscribe now to get daily updates.